首页> 外国专利> A method for local reconstruction of mold problem areas on the inside of an outer sleeve of buildings and also the use of a largely impermeable to water vapor filling material having a highly heat-insulating properties

The invention relates to a method for the local reconstruction of mold problem areas (10) on the inner side of an outer shell of a building, as well as the use of a largely impermeable to water vapor filling material having a highly thermally insulating properties in the form of a filler material or a foam as a replacement for the ground surface is removed on the inside of the outer shell of a building in the region of a geometric heat bridge. In order to permit a simple and sustainable repair of the heat caused by the geometrical of the outer mold problem areas (10) without manual special knowledge and construction of the invention is to enable the proposed according to the invention that, in the mold problem areas (10) background of the inner side of the outer shell is removed and in that a during removal of the constructional component, resulting recess (44) with a hardenable filling material (46) is filled, the highly heat insulating properties and for water vapor is impermeable to the greatest possible extent.
